But, I wanted to pass along some general details about the 2014 CHSUL City Tournament.
What: CHSUL City Tournament
When: Saturday, May 3 - Sunday, May 4 // 9am
Games will begin at 9am both days and each team can expect to play 3 games per day. Expect to wrap up around 4.
It's very important for the integrity of the tournament that all teams play all of their games. When one team forfeits or doesn't show up on Sunday, it makes a mess of the bracket and leaves teams without games to play, which is unfair to them. So, it's expected that all teams play their games; failure to do so may result in postseason bans next year. If you think this will be an issue for your team, please let me know now.
I'll have the specific tournament format for everyone soon, but it will consist of pool play on Saturday and bracket play on Sunday.
Originally, pool play was going to keep separate the Tier I and Tier II teams, with the top two teams from Tier II playing into the championship bracket. But with all the parody in the league this season, I'm still considering a few different options.
We will be having a cookout again on Saturday afternoon following our pool play games.
The top teams will earn bids to the state tournament the following weekend. Last year, we had 3 bids for states. I'm not sure how many bids Columbus is to receive for this year's state tournament as of yet. Once I know, I'll pass along the info. In year's past, we've had either 3 or 4 bids.
